Output 16dfb4c07302d17cf8d6f7f5602da4ccdb1c5b7bd575478d5e298a8d23c0b0cf:0

value
1398593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f177d77cdc995a0afb62c307a993be3a9efa705 OP_EQUAL
address
334pCYRcxctDcArVj11E4mAVaeC2XS43nP
transaction
16dfb4c07302d17cf8d6f7f5602da4ccdb1c5b7bd575478d5e298a8d23c0b0cf
confirmations
341518
spent
true